How much does SR-22 insurance cost?

The price of SR-22 insurance can differ extensively based upon various factors such as an individual's driving record, the reason for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the vehicle driver resides. The prompt economic influence can be found in the type of a filing fee, which usually varies from $15 to $25. Nonetheless, the more significant cost comes from the anticipated increase in auto insurance rate. The statement of a policy gap resulting in a demand for SR-22 attracts the representation of the driver as high threat in the eyes of auto insurance carriers. A risky tag can attribute substantially to the hike in monthly prices.

Additional making complex the cost calculation is the sort of protection required. While a non-owner car insurance policy might cost less than an owner's plan, the explicit requirement for an enhanced quantity of protection can rise premiums. Most states mandate a minimum quantity of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a fair quantity should be reflected in the insurance policy bundled with the SR-22 kind.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which requires also higher liability insurance coverage, may be a required. In short, while the actual cost of submitting an SR-22 form is reasonably low, the indirect costs resulting from its effect on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can produce a hole in your pocket.

What's the distinction in between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both types of insurance qualifications made use of by states to validate a car driver's financial responsibility and ensure they meet the particular state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The substantial difference between these certificates mainly hinges on the purpose they serve and the liability limits. With an SR-22, typically needed for people with DUIs or serious driving offenses, the liability requirements are similar to those of an average cars and truck insurance policy. This certification can be obtained by including it to a current policy or by securing a non-owner policy if the person doesn't have a car.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to two states-- Virginia and Florida, and includes greater liability limits, particularly for bodily injury liability. It's usually mandated for people needing to have a hardship license after a significant driving offense, such as a drunk driving where injury or considerable home damage happened. In addition, FR-44 filing period is normally longer and the average price more than that of SR-22, as a result of the enhanced protection it calls for. The privileges of preserving a valid license with an FR-44 filing come with the strict problem of maintaining a clean record and maintaining comprehensive coverage throughout the needed period. This ensures the state of the individual's commitment to safer, more responsible driving in the future.

What takes place if an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ated?

The cancellation of an SR-22 insurance policy can commonly result in serious effects. When an insurance policy hol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ether due to non-payment, policy lapse, or any other factor - insurance carriers have a task to notify the proper state authorities concerning this modification. This is completed by submitting an SR-26 kind, which successfully represents the end of the policyholder's SR-22 insurance coverage.

When the proper state authorities have been notified of the cancellation of SR-22 insurance, the affected vehicle driver's certificate can possibly be put on hold once more. This results from the authorities' need to make sure that the vehicle drivers are continually insured while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Hence, the car driver might need to look for non-owner SR-22 insurance if the car was not in their possession at the time of the termination. This reinstatement of the motorist's SR-22 requirement can lead to even more headaches down the line, in addition to possible boosts in insurance premiums. Proactivity in keeping an SR-22 insurance policy is extremely suggested to avoid such scenarios.
